Position Summary:
The Clinician will be responsible for a variety of services including assessments, treatment planning, participant education, documentation, and therapy sessions.
Essential Duties:
- Maintain clinical supervision, including review of student (student/participant) files, and have the ability to perform initial and/or ongoing student (student/participant) assessments.
- Provide mental health structured therapeutic services.
- Provide gender-responsive, trauma-informed, structured treatment services, including implementation of trauma-informed curriculum.
- Provide individual, family, and group counseling
- Provide specialized classes and workshops relevant to the population (including Domestic Violence, Incest Survivors, Family Relationships, other topics as needed).
- Work with the Managing Director to develop and maintain the program culture.
- Ensure the program has family-focused services and is trauma-informed.
- Integrate the assessed and stated goals of student (participants) work in coordination with the ARC/JCOD staff in determining continuum of care services for student (participants) including educational and vocational planning.
- Participate in case conferences.
- Responsible for all aspects of medical, dental, mental health related appointments, including making appointments, follow-up, arranging transportation and prescriptions.
Minimum Qualifications:
- Experience / Knowledge:
- Registered with the Board of Behavioral Science or Licensed Clinical Social Worker (LCSW)
-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ist (LMFT), or
- Another professional licensed by the State of California to provide mental health services in California.
- AND Minimum of two (2) years of experience in providing trauma-informed services preferably to women.
- Certification:
- Within six (6) weeks of hire, obtain First Aid and CPR certification AND pass a physical examination and tuberculosis test from a health professional.
